Early Victorian Coral Manu Fica Pendant aigrette A sensational Victorian cameo broochDATE: Victorian, c. 1840 Cool antique coral 'manu fica' amulet dating from the early Victorian period, circa 1840. It's gold topped with finely engraved detailing, and the coral is coloured beautifully a slightly muted pinkish orange. The coral is Italian, likely picked up by a Grand Tourer on the Roman leg of their European adventure.
